As an Event Administrator, you will be responsible for managing projects from start to finish, ensuring their timely completion and accuracy.

Your role will involve developing and monitoring event schedules, maintaining communication with team members and clients, and serving as a valuable point of contact with our clients.

We are looking for a confident, professional, and reliable individual with strong communication, collaboration, and organizational skills. This position will be a hybrid role, with a combination of in-office and work-from-home responsibilities.


Responsibilities:


Event Planning and Coordination:

  • Collaborate with clients to obtain necessary data to initiate and prepare events.
  • Prepare and obtain approval for event invitation design as well as guest list management.
  • Coordinate with vendors and suppliers to secure necessary services and resources.
  • Create and maintain event timelines and schedules.

Administrative Support:

  • Prepare agreements for new and existing clients.
  • Manage event databases and maintain accurate records of attendee information.
  • Manage confidential information with care and discretion.
  • Handle general administrative tasks such as filing, data entry, and correspondence.

Communication and Stakeholder Management:

  • Serve as a primary point of contact for clients, vendors, and internal teams.
  • Communicate event details, updates, and requirements effectively and promptly.
  • Coordinate with marketing and communication teams to develop eventrelated content and collateral.
  • Collaborate with team to ensure their understanding of event objectives, roles, and responsibilities.

Requirements:


  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to multitask and prioritize effectively.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Attention to detail and ability to maintain accuracy in fastpaced environments.
  • Proficient in using Microsoft 365, with an indepth understanding of Excel (ability to work with large datasets, pivot tables, and data manipulation is essential).
  • Ability to work both independently and collaboratively in a team environment.
  • Exceptional problemsolving and decisionmaking abilities.
  • Proactive in resolving challenges that may arise during projects.
  • Flexibility to work irregular hours, including evenings and weekends, as required by event schedules.
  • Professionalism, adaptability, and a positive attitude.
  • Adobe InDesign experience and/or experience editing HTML would be a definite asset.
